The multi-jointed machine is similar to a human arm and is characterized by its ability to move flexibly like a human hand. For example, when encountering an obstacle, the multi-joint robot can bypass the obstacle to reach the target, which is difficult for the general polar or cylindrical coordinate type industrial robot. If some special movements (crank motion) are required to be completed, the multi-joint robot is also easier to complete. A multi-jointed robot can also move from one point to another in as little time as a human hand.

The industrial robot arm is usually composed of the main body, the drive system, the control system and so on. The main part includes each joint and connecting rod of the mechanical arm, which together constitute the motion mechanism of the mechanical arm. The driving system provides power for the movement of the robot arm, and the common driving methods are motor drive, hydraulic drive and pneumatic drive. The control system is responsible for receiving instructions and controlling the motion trajectory and action sequence of the robot arm.

transfer robot is an industrial robot that can carry out automated handling operations. The first handling robots appeared in the United States in 1960, when Versatran and Unimate were first used in handling operations. Handling operation refers to holding the workpiece with a piece of equipment, which refers to moving from one processing position to another processing position. The handling robot can install different end-effectors to complete the handling of various workpieces of different shapes and states, which greatly reduces the heavy manual labor of human beings.

In the spraying operation, in order to ensure the uniformity of the coating, the coating must be atomized. The paint mist produced in the atomization process, as well as the solvent and other volatile gases in the paint, have flammable characteristics, if the spraying operation and protection are improper, it is easy to cause fire and explosion.
